JNCIP-ENT Layer 2 Authentication And Access Control Practice Question
You are configuring an EX Series switch to use MAC RADIUS authentication. You notice that when devices connect, the switch sends authentication requests, but the accounting start packets are not being sent. What configuration is missing?

You did not configure the accounting server and enable accounting under the access-profile hierarchy.
To enable accounting along with MAC RADIUS, you must explicitly enable accounting under the access profile associated with the interface.

AAA Protocol Comparison
| Protocol | Port(s) | Encryption | Transport | Primary Use |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| RADIUS | 1812 / 1813 | Password only | UDP | Network access control |
| TACACS+ | 49 | Full packet | TCP | Device administration |
| Diameter | 3868 | Full session | TCP / SCTP | Carrier / mobile networks |
| 802.1X | — | EAP-based | Layer 2 | Port-based access control |
TACACS+ encrypts the entire packet; RADIUS only encrypts the password field — a key exam distinction.
